TODAY IN HISTORY (OCTOBER 26) 740 - An earthquake strikes Constantinople, causing much damage and death. 1366 - Comet 55P/1366 U1 (Tempel-Tuttle) approaches 0.0229 AUs of Earth 1387 - Amsterdam buccaneer Herman of Kuinre sign peace 1407 - Mobs attack Jewish community of Cracow 1492 - Columbus fleet anchors on Ragged Island Range, Bahamas 1492 - Lead pencils 1st used 1524 - Spanish troops give Milan to France 1529 - Thomas More appointed English Lord Chancellor 1534 - Charles V names Joris of Egmont, bishop of Utrecht 1662 - Charles II of England sold Dunkirk to France 1667 - Aru Palakkas occupies Makassar (Goa) 1674 - Prince Willem III occupies Grave 1682 - William Penn accepts area around Delaware River from Duke of York 1749 - Georgia Colony reverses itself & rules slavery is legal 1774 - 1st Continental Congress adjourns in Philadelphia.
